East Anshan iron mine are becoming a single bucket-Truck Belt-semi continuous process from a single bucket railway and shovel truck technology.The change and efficiency of the production process need good blasting quality as the basis.We need to determine the optimal blasting parameters.The effect and analysis of blasting is the premise to ensure the blasting quality. In this paper, the field conditions in east Anshan iron mine by blasting, quality evaluation, inspection of blasting effect can be improved.In order to solve the problems above, in this paper,the system of blast fragmentation analysis and blasting optimization has been established by using the stope geologic investigation,test analysis, computer intelligent algorithm, image morphology theory and method.The system including scale design, algorithm design, software development, morphological reconstruction, the system uses morphological analysis and reconstruction technology, and realized the weight simulation provides support for screening, prediction of blasting effect. Through the establishment of blasting optimization neural network model, we can predict the blasting effect. A fast and reliable blasting effect evaluation method, evaluation method can change the laggard consumption to two blasting blasting quality evaluation in the past, improve mine blasting quality and production efficiency, this also can improve the economic benefits of the mine.
